Deuces Free: To win Deuces free, you must first get a five card poker hand. Once you have a hand you can decide which card to hold and which one to replace. The combination of the cards after replacement determines whether you win. If you win, you can choose between the collect option or double option. Double option allows the dealer to draw a face-up card, and the player to choose from four face-down cards. If the card chosen falls below the dealer's, then the player loses the original win. If the cards are even, it's a tie. In this case, the player can collect the original winnings.

Tight playing can be done even before pre-flop. For instance, after the flop, you as the tight player realize that your chances of winning have seriously deteriorated, then you should fold. Simply put, tight players play hands only if the hands they are dealt are good. If they don't, they fold.
